How much do container loader j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for container loader in Methuen, MA is $18.30,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.11 and $19.62 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some common challenges faced by a container loader, and how can they be addressed?

Container Loaders often encounter challenges such as managing heavy or awkwardly shaped cargo, working efficiently under time constraints, and ensuring items are securely packed to prevent damage during transit. To address these, it's important to follow proper lifting techniques, use appropriate equipment, and adhere to safety protocols. Clear communication with team members and supervisors is also key to coordinating loading activities and resolving issues quickly. Many companies provide on-the-job training to help workers develop these skills and promote a safe, productive environ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a container loader,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Container Loader, you need physical stamina, attention to detail, and basic understanding of warehouse operations,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with pallet jacks, forklifts, and inventory management systems is typically required, with OSHA forklift certification being a common asset. Strong teamwork, time management, and communication skills help individuals excel in fast-paced environments. These abilities are crucial for ensuring safe, efficient, and accurate loading processes that support overall supply chain effectiveness.

What is a container loader?

Container loaders are workers responsible for efficiently loading and unloading goods into shipping containers, trucks, or freight vehicles. Their main tasks include arranging cargo to maximize space, securing items to prevent damage during transit, and following safety protocols. They often use equipment like forklifts, pallet jacks, or hand trucks and must keep accurate records of loaded items. Container loaders play a vital role in the supply chain by ensuring goods are transported safely and efficiently.

What is the difference between Container Loader vs Forklift Operator?

AspectContainer LoaderForklift Operator
CredentialsTypically requires a high school diploma and safety trainingRequires forklift certification and safety training
Work EnvironmentLoading/unloading containers, warehouse, shipping yardsOperating forklifts in warehouses, distribution centers
Industry UsageShipping, logistics, freight forwardingWarehousing, manufacturing, logistics
Common Search/ComparisonContainer Loader vs Forklift Operator

Container Loaders and Forklift Operators both work in logistics and warehousing environments, often overlapping in tasks like moving goods. However, Container Loaders focus on loading goods into containers, requiring knowledge of cargo handling, while Forklift Operators operate forklifts to move pallets and materials within facilities. Both roles require safety training and certifications, but their specific duties and work settings differ slightly.

JOB SUMMARY
Responsible for delivery and pickup of containers to and/or from customer locations; provide an effective and incident free delivery or pickup of a container while maintaining excellent rapport with the customer.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Drive and operate a commercial truck with a patented lift mechanism to load and unload containers at customer sites in a safe manner by following all safety rules
  • Perform and log daily pre and post trip inspections of commercial vehicle and lift
  • Accept add-on deliveries as required to meet business needs
  • Use company handheld computer for delivery verification and navigation
  • Operate a forklift and/or an overhead crane
  • Clean and inspect containers to ensure they are presentable for delivery to customer
  • Coordinate rental paperwork and payment with the customer
  • Communicate with the Driver Lead or Market Manager on customer questions and/or issues; Prepare driver notes as needed
  • Perform repairs of containers and lifts in the field and at the storage center
  • Provide backup for storage center functions when needed
  • Maintain cleanliness of truck cab (keep free from debris inside and outside)
  • May perform other duties and responsibilities as assigned
